Transaction 03d4063358a847eec32da2cb59bbd08aeb0ac43f34d8c8d59a60645c6f3643d3
1 Input
1 Output
-
03d4063358a847eec32da2cb59bbd08aeb0ac43f34d8c8d59a60645c6f3643d3:0
- value
- 67405
- script pubkey
- OP_0 OP_PUSHBYTES_20 48fb4046ca1c372097b4060006c5569242289f5a
- address
- bc1qfra5q3k2rsmjp9a5qcqqd32kjfpz3866p9evvg